How Generative AI Transforms Medical Translation in 2026

In 2026, generative AI is fundamentally changing how medical translation services operate — enabling healthcare providers to translate medical documents faster, support qualified medical interpreters with context-aware language suggestions, and help healthcare organizations overcome language barriers that have long compromised patient safety. This blog explores what that shift looks like in practice, why the human element in medical interpretation remains indispensable, and how language services providers are rising to meet the growing demand for accurate, secure, and scalable healthcare communication. Why Language Barriers in Healthcare Remain a Critical Challenge Language barriers in healthcare are not a new problem, but their consequences are just as serious today as they have ever been. When a patient who speaks a different language cannot clearly describe symptoms, or when a family member is pressed into interpreting a complex treatment plan, communication breaks down — and patient safety is put at risk. The numbers tell a clear story. Hundreds of millions of people worldwide seek healthcare in a language other than their native one. In the US alone, Spanish is the most requested language for interpretation in clinical settings, but healthcare workers routinely encounter patients speaking Arabic, Mandarin, Tagalog, Portuguese, and dozens of other languages. In Europe, migration patterns have created similar multilingual realities across healthcare systems that were historically built around one language. Overcoming language barriers is not just a matter of courtesy — it is a clinical necessity. Miscommunicated diagnoses, misunderstood medication instructions, and uninformed consent are all downstream consequences of unaddressed communication barriers. For healthcare providers, ensuring patient safety means building language access into the care delivery process itself, not treating it as an afterthought. Medical Translation Services in 2026: Beyond Machine Translation For years, machine translation was viewed with skepticism in medical settings — and for good reason. Early systems struggled with specialized terminology, failed to preserve clinical nuance, and produced errors that could mislead rather than inform. In 2026, that has changed substantially. Generative AI trained on large volumes of clinical and medical content can now handle complex medical terminology with significantly greater accuracy, differentiate contextual meanings (the word “depression” means something very different in psychiatry than in cardiology), and maintain consistency across long documents. Healthcare organizations are seeing real gains in turnaround time for translated medical documents, with workflows that once took days now completing in hours. The shift has been particularly impactful for healthcare organizations managing content at scale — translating patient-facing materials, updating clinical guidelines, and maintaining informed consent documents across multiple target languages simultaneously. Generative AI makes this operationally feasible in ways it simply was not before. That said, medical translation services in 2026 are not purely automated. For critical documents — particularly those involved in clinical trials, regulatory submissions, or legal compliance — a certified medical translator reviewing and approving AI output remains standard practice. The result is a hybrid model that combines speed with the accuracy that high-stakes medical communication demands. The Medical Interpreter and Medical Interpretation: A Human Skill AI Enhances A medical interpreter does far more than convert words from one language to another. Skilled medical interpretation involves conveying tone, urgency, emotional nuance, and cultural context — the full weight of a conversation between a patient and a healthcare provider. A qualified medical interpreter working in oncology, for example, must navigate not just terminology but deeply sensitive discussions about prognosis, treatment options, and quality of life. Generative AI has not replaced this human expertise — and in high-stakes settings, it should not. What it has done is extend the reach of medical interpretation to situations where a qualified interpreter cannot be physically present. Real-time AI-assisted communication has made language access possible in emergency settings, rural clinics, and specialist consultations where previously a patient and provider might have struggled to communicate at all. The most responsible healthcare organizations treat this as an expansion of capacity, not a shortcut. Certified interpreters remain the standard for mental health assessments, surgical consent, palliative care, and any encounter where the emotional and clinical stakes are highest. AI extends language access; experienced, certified interpreters deliver it at its most critical. Translating Medical Documents: From Clinical Trials to Consent Forms Medical documents represent one of the most demanding translation challenges in any sector. The stakes of a terminology error in a clinical trials protocol, a prescribing guide, or a patient consent form extend well beyond the document itself — inaccurate translation can directly affect patient outcomes and create serious regulatory compliance exposure for healthcare organizations. Generative AI has made it possible to accelerate the translation of these documents while maintaining quality through human review at key stages. This model — often called machine translation post-editing — allows a medical translator to work with a high-quality draft rather than starting from scratch, significantly reducing turnaround time without compromising accuracy. For healthcare organizations managing content across dozens of target languages, this scalability is transformative. Maintaining aligned, up-to-date translations of core documents across a global operation used to be a resource-intensive challenge. In 2026, it is increasingly manageable — provided that the underlying language services infrastructure is built for medical content specifically, not repurposed from general-purpose translation tools. Language Services, Data Security, and GDPR Compliant Workflows Any discussion of medical translation services must address data security directly. Patient medical records, clinical histories, and research data are among the most sensitive categories of personal information that exist. Healthcare providers using language services carry a responsibility to ensure that their translation workflows handle this data with the same rigor as their clinical systems. In 2026, GDPR compliant data handling is a baseline requirement for any language services provider operating in or with European healthcare organizations — and HIPAA compliance applies across US-based healthcare contexts. This means end-to-end encryption, strict access controls, documented data retention policies, and full accountability for how patient data flows through the translation process. Healthcare organizations should evaluate any language services partner on data security as rigorously as they evaluate translation quality. The two are inseparable in a healthcare context. Boost Global Sales with Instant AI Translation for E-Commerce

Instant AI translation is a game changer for ecommerce teams that want to expand internationally fast. This blog explains how ecommerce businesses can use ai translation and machine translation (including popular tools like Google Translate) alongside translation memory, custom glossaries and human editing to deliver accurate translated content across multiple languages and file formats — driving conversion, saving time and protecting brand voice while complying with rules. Why ecommerce and AI translation belong together Cross-border shoppers expect product pages, checkout flows, help articles and marketing in their preferred language. For an ecommerce company, translated content that reads naturally is no longer a “nice-to-have” — it directly affects conversion. Neural machine translation and automatic translation now produce high-quality drafts in dozens of language pairs, letting teams localize product catalogs, user interfaces and ads quickly. With translation tools and ai agents, companies reduce manual heavy lifting while giving localization managers and product managers the control they need to keep translations consistent with brand voice. Machine translation: fast, scalable, and a huge time saver Machine translation (MT) and automated translation tools provide instant translated content for entire websites and back catalogues. Paired with translation memory and custom glossaries, MT becomes more accurate over time — delivering consistent translations that respect recurring phrases, SKU names and legal wording. For ecommerce, that means: Faster time-to-market for new product lines. Lower cost per word compared with fully human translation. The ability to A/B test localized messaging quickly across markets. But machine translation alone isn’t always perfect — idiomatic expressions, complex technical specs and legal content benefit from human editing and quality control to ensure translated content is accurate and compliant. How automatic translation and Google Translate fit into workflows Many teams start with free or enterprise versions of automatic translation tools (including the service mentioned above) to translate bulk content or generate first drafts. These tools let you: Upload CSVs, XLSX catalogs and JSON product feeds in the right file formats for easy translation. Integrate via APIs into content delivery systems and headless CMS for continuous localization. Use translation memory to avoid re-translating identical strings across SKUs and pages. A smart workflow uses automated translation for speed and human translators for review of high-impact pages (checkout, legal, marketing campaigns). That “machine-first, human-refine” approach is a proven commercial model that balances speed, quality and cost. Automatic translation for international business growth If your company wants to expand into new territories, automatic translation reduces startup friction. Translating product descriptions, help guides, and email flows into multiple languages can be the difference between a failed market test and product-market fit. Benefits for international business include: Reaching new audiences without hiring a local team immediately. Faster market experiments with localized landing pages. Consistent translations that preserve brand voice when using translation tools and custom glossaries. Localization managers should still run quality checks and sample human edits to ensure cultural nuance and regulatory compliance. File formats, language tools, and translation tools: technical must-haves Ecommerce catalogs come in many file formats — CSV, XLSX, JSON, XML and even DOCX or PPT for B2B collateral. Choose translation tools that: Support your file formats natively so the structure and metadata (SKUs, IDs, tags) remain intact. Preserve markup, HTML and placeholders so translated pages display correctly. Export approved translations back into your systems for immediate content delivery. Integrations with CMS, PIM and order systems make the entire process seamless: upload → translate → review → publish. That flow is what turns translated content into sales-ready pages. AI agents, localization expert workflows and the entire process Modern localization workflows combine ai agents that automate specific tasks (file ingestion, pre-translation, QA checks) with human localization experts who handle context-sensitive editing. A typical pipeline: Product manager uploads an original document or product feed. An ai agent pre-processes content, extracts translatable strings and applies translation memory. Machine translation (neural machine translation) produces draft translations across language pairs. Localization expert or human translators review and apply brand glossaries, idiomatic fixes and legal checks. Approved translations are exported in the correct file formats and deployed. This hybrid approach keeps costs down while protecting translation quality and brand voice — a real game changer for busy ecommerce teams. Translation quality: why human editing still matters Automated translation tools are powerful, but quality control ensures your translated content converts. Human translators and localization experts add: Context-aware wording for product features and benefits. Corrections for idiomatic expressions that machines may mistranslate. Checks for regulatory phrases (especially in markets governed by the European Union and national authorities). Final alignment with brand tone so the translated content feels native to the target audience. Even small investments in post-editing can have a significant impact on conversions in high-value markets — for example, a French audience often expects polished marketing language; machine-only translations may require edits to match expectations. Continuous localization: update once, publish everywhere Ecommerce sites change frequently — new products, updated specs, seasonal offers. Continuous localization integrates translation tools into your development and marketing pipelines so content updates automatically: New or changed strings are detected and queued for translation immediately. Translation memory reduces cost by reusing previously translated phrases. Approved translations can be deployed automatically to the right store fronts and regions. This continuous approach transforms localization from a project into an ongoing capability, which is essential for scaling international business. Custom glossaries, TM and preserving brand voice A tailored glossary and translation memory are invaluable. They lock down product names, trademarks and preferred phrasing so automated translation yields consistent results. For ecommerce: Create a glossary for product names, measurements, warranty terms and local legal terms. Feed glossaries to both machine translation and human translators. Train your machine learning models with approved translations to improve future automated translations. This ensures that even when AI does the heavy lifting, the final translated content stays on-brand. Breaking Language Barriers in Healthcare With AI Translation

Healthcare translation services powered by AI translation are reshaping how hospitals, clinics, and health plans in the United States deliver care to multilingual patients. This blog explores how AI-driven language access improves communication, supports HIPAA-compliant workflows, and drives better health outcomes. It also outlines when to use AI versus professional interpretation (in person, video, or virtual), how tools like Google Translate differ from secure healthcare solutions, and how healthcare providers can scale multilingual communication safely and effectively. Healthcare Translation Services: Why language access matters in U.S. care Language barriers in healthcare are not just an inconvenience — they are a measurable risk to patient safety and equitable access. Hospitals and healthcare organizations must provide healthcare language services so that non-English speaking patients and those with limited English proficiency receive accurate patient materials, informed consent, and discharge instructions. Effective healthcare translation services — including localization services for patient portals and forms — reduce errors, improve adherence to treatment, and support regulatory alignment with Title VI and Section 1557 civil rights requirements. Interpretation Services: in person vs AI-assisted options Interpretation services come in many forms: in person interpreters, phone interpreting, video interpreting, and real-time ai translations using neural machine translation and generative AI tools. Each method has a place: In person / professional interpreters — best for high-stakes conversations (consent, mental health, critical care). These qualified interpreters provide cultural nuance and non-verbal cues. Video interpreters / remote interpreting — excellent for rapid access across multiple sites and for ASL (American Sign Language) needs. AI translations & machine translation — great for scaling written content (patient education, patient portals) and for initial triage in telehealth, when combined with human review (MTPE — machine translation post-editing). Healthcare providers should adopt a tiered model: AI for routine, low-risk tasks (translations fast for patient materials), with human interpreter oversight for clinical decision-making. Healthcare Providers: choosing AI translations that protect privacy and compliance When healthcare organizations choose ai translations, the selection criteria must include regulatory compliance, translation accuracy, and patient privacy. Look for vendors that are HIPAA compliant, offer data encryption, and explicitly state whether training data may be retained. Health plans and hospitals must also map workflows to Section 1557 and the Civil Rights Act obligations for language access. Operational tips for providers: Require vendor attestation for HIPAA compliant data handling and patient privacy safeguards. Keep critical conversations with professional interpreters when clinical risk is present. Maintain brand voice consistent across translated patient materials and follow style guides for clinical terms and medical terminology. Healthcare Language Translation Services: applying AI to patient materials and portals Healthcare language translation services powered by neural machine translation make it easier and faster for organizations to localize a wide range of patient-facing content, including: Consent forms and discharge instructions Patient education materials and FAQs Patient portals, appointment reminders, and billing statements A best-practice approach is to use machine translation to create initial drafts, followed by human post-editing to ensure clinical accuracy and clarity. For patient portals and mobile applications, localization services go beyond simple word-for-word translation — they help ensure that user interfaces, error messages, and help text are culturally appropriate and easy to understand for diverse patient populations. AI Tools, Google Translate, and the Role of Human Interpreters Many care teams wonder whether they can simply paste text into Google Translate for patient communication. The short answer is no — not for clinical use. While Google Translate has improved significantly, it does not provide reliable guarantees around translation accuracy, data retention policies, or regulatory compliance. It may be acceptable for casual, low-risk, non-clinical communication (such as asking a patient’s preferred language), but it should not be used for medical or sensitive information. Best practices: Use Google Translate only for low-risk, informal exchanges or as an initial reference. Rely on certified healthcare translation services or professional interpreters for medical records, prescriptions, and any critical clinical information. AI translations and health outcomes: accuracy, human oversight, and quality Research and real-world experience consistently show that better language access leads to better patient understanding, adherence, and overall health outcomes. AI translations can dramatically expand access and speed, but accuracy remains crucial — especially when dealing with complex medical terminology. To ensure quality, healthcare organizations should: Regularly measure translation accuracy through human review and sample audits. Use human-in-the-loop models where clinicians or professional linguists validate high-stakes content. Track patient outcomes and patient experience metrics after AI deployment. When used responsibly, AI becomes a true game changer — reducing the burden on bilingual staff, speeding up communication, and enabling more consistent and compassionate patient interactions across all care settings. Health Plans & Healthcare Settings: implementing AI across different care settings Health plans and healthcare providers operate across a wide range of healthcare settings — including emergency departments, outpatient clinics, telehealth platforms, and community health centers — and each environment requires a slightly different approach to language support. Here’s how AI and interpretation can be applied effectively across settings: Emergency Departments (EDs): Prioritize fast access to video interpreters or on-call bilingual staff to avoid delays in care. Telehealth: Use real-time AI translations during virtual meetings to support smoother remote consultations. Chronic Care Management: Localize long-form patient materials and patient portals into multiple languages so patients can better understand their conditions and treatment plans. To implement this successfully, organizations should align AI translation efforts with their clinical, legal, and IT teams, ensure regulatory compliance, and maintain clear documentation of workflows. Scaling multilingual communication in healthcare A thoughtful approach to multilingual communication starts with two key questions: how many languages do your patients speak, and when is in-person interpretation truly necessary? Healthcare organizations can begin by: Reviewing patient demographics to understand preferred languages and usage patterns. Prioritizing languages based on patient volume and clinical risk (Spanish is often a top priority in the U.S.). Using video interpreters or AI translation for lower-volume languages to provide equitable access without high on-site costs. By combining professional interpreters, video interpreters, bilingual staff, and AI translations, healthcare providers can support multiple languages while maintaining quality and consistency. AI vs Human Subtitles: Which Is Best for Video Localization in 2026?

Video localization is a core capability for organizations seeking global reach in 2026. Audiences expect video subtitles that make content accessible across multiple languages and platforms while preserving tone and intent. The decision to use an ai subtitle workflow, professional human subtitling, or a hybrid approach influences accuracy, time-to-market, and the viewer experience for non-native speakers. This article compares the approaches, explains practical workflows, and offers recommendations for business decision-makers. Understanding AI-Generated Subtitles How an auto subtitle generator works An auto subtitle generator ingests a video file or audio files, uses speech recognition to transcribe spoken content, applies timestamps, and — when needed — translates text into target languages. Platforms let teams upload a video, automatically generate subtitles, then export SRT or hardcoded subtitles, or use an online video editor to embed captions directly into a video file. Many systems also provide a subtitle editor so teams can manually edit, adjust subtitle style, and export finished files. Operational advantages: speed, scale, and integration Automated workflows enable teams to generate subtitles at scale with consistent rules for line length, reading speed, and speaker labeling. For social media videos and product demos, the ability to auto generate subtitles and create captions quickly reduces time-to-publish and lowers per-minute costs. Enterprise platforms often provide a full suite that supports bulk video upload, batch processing, confidence scoring, and automatic captions for live streams — helping teams keep content accessible across channels. Practical limitations to manage Automated transcripts perform well when audio is clear, speakers are distinct, and background music is controlled. In situations with multiple speakers, overlapping dialogue, or domain-specific terminology, confidence scores and an integrated subtitle editor let teams target manual edits where they matter most. This selective review approach preserves scale while improving final quality. Understanding Human-Created Subtitles Role and strengths of professional subtitlers Professional linguists and subtitle experts apply editorial judgment to pacing, tone, and cultural nuance. They craft translated subtitles that read naturally for target audiences and ensure closed captions meet accessibility and regulatory requirements. For content requiring verbatim accuracy or precise legal phrasing, human subtitlers are the preferred option. Trade-offs: time and cost Human workflows require staffing and project management. Turnaround times and cost scale with duration and the number of languages. These trade-offs are often justified for high-impact campaigns, e-learning modules, and regulated content where accuracy and localization depth directly affect outcomes. AI vs. Human Subtitles: A Direct Comparison to generate subtitles at scale Accuracy and quality Automated systems provide consistent baseline transcripts and translated subtitles rapidly. Human subtitlers deliver higher contextual fidelity for idioms, humor, and culturally specific references. Many organizations use automated transcription to produce a first pass and then apply human review selectively to improve quality. Cultural nuance and localization depth When translations must resonate with local audiences, human review preserves message intent while adapting phrasing. Automated translation supports breadth across multiple languages; human editing supplies depth and naturalness for priority markets. Turnaround time and scalability Automatic captions and auto generated captions shorten time-to-publish for live and near-live content. Human processes take longer but produce validated outputs for formal releases. A hybrid model balances speed and accuracy by combining generated automatically outputs with targeted human edits. Cost considerations Auto subtitle solutions lower incremental costs as volume grows; human subtitling incurs direct labor expenses. For many enterprise programs, hybrid workflows optimize budget allocation by applying human effort where it provides the greatest business value. Technical considerations: multiple speakers, closed captions, and formats Multiple speakers and noisy audio Platforms vary in speaker diarization capabilities. Look for tools that tag multiple speakers and provide confidence metrics so editors can correct low-confidence segments in the subtitle editor. Background music and audio quality Background music can impact transcription accuracy. Tools that offer noise reduction or separate audio tracks improve baseline results and reduce manual editing. Closed captions and export formats Confirm support for closed captions (required for many accessibility standards) and export formats such as SRT, VTT, and hardcoded subtitles. The ability to add captions directly during video upload or through an online video editor simplifies distribution across platforms like YouTube and social media. The Hybrid Approach: The practical path forward in 2026 How AI + human review combines strengths A hybrid workflow transcribes and timestamps content with an ai subtitle generator, translates into multiple languages, and routes outputs to human linguists for selective review. Editors focus on low-confidence segments, culturally sensitive passages, and brand-critical lines. This approach reduces manual labor while ensuring content accessible and accurate for target audiences. Workflow components that matter Bulk video upload and batch processing for large libraries. A robust subtitle editor to manually edit auto generated captions and finalize subtitle style. Quality checks that surface low-confidence segments for human review. Export options for SRT, VTT, and hardcoded subtitles to suit distribution requirements. Closed captions to make content accessible for viewers with hearing impairments. Enterprise benefits Hybrid systems deliver predictable SLAs, reduce time-to-publish, and support multiple languages while controlling cost. They enable teams to add subtitles and create captions quickly while preserving quality where it matters. Where AI-powered subtitles and translation are most effective today AI-driven subtitle and translation workflows are now firmly embedded in several high-volume, fast-moving content areas where speed, consistency, and scalability are priorities. In these use cases, AI is widely adopted because it enables teams to auto generate subtitles, add captions, and localize video content efficiently across multiple languages. AI subtitles are commonly used for social media videos, short-form marketing assets, and user-generated content, where rapid turnaround is essential and content lifecycles are short. Automated subtitles allow teams to publish frequently, keep content accessible, and reach wider audiences without slowing production cycles. They are also effective for product demos, feature walkthroughs, and internal training videos, especially when the language is relatively structured and terminology is consistent. In these scenarios, AI-generated video subtitles help teams create captions at scale, while optional human review can be applied for customer-facing or high-visibility materials.
